This is an amazing campground.In terms of location, it is hard to beat. You're about an hour from San Francisco, and thirty minutes from San Jose. If you need to get groceries, you're about ten minutes from the store.The campground itself is stellar. Spots are spacious. The fire ring is nice. Because you're right on the bay it does get heinously windy but otherwise you're good.The bathrooms are clean.There is a rule that you can't drive into the park past 10 PM, but ride-sharing and then walking is okay.There are miles and miles of hiking trails that extend from the end of the park. On top of that, there is a rafter of turkeys that wanders through the park. There are also a million blackbirds, bluebirds and finches that call the park home.The price is reasonable, especially given the exorbitant prices of everything else out here.All in all, I would recommend it and return. - Sam Nichols

The environment at Dumbarton Quarry Campground on the Bay is one of its most remarkable features. As its name suggests, it is "right on the bay," providing stunning views of the San Francisco Bay. While this proximity can lead to it getting "heinously windy," it also offers incredible scenic beauty, especially from elevated vantage points like the Bay View Trail, where one can "clearly see both SF and Oakland skylines." The campground is nestled within a natural landscape that supports abundant wildlife; visitors have noted the presence of "a rafter of turkeys that wanders through the park," along with "a million blackbirds, bluebirds and finches that call the park home." This rich avian life makes it a fantastic spot for bird watching. The landscape transitions from the immediate bayfront to areas with "miles and miles of hiking trails that extend from the end of the park," providing ample opportunities for exploring diverse terrains. The setting is surprisingly quiet given its proximity to major roadways, suggesting good sound dampening or a well-designed layout, though visitors should be aware of being "in flight path of SFO and OAK airports," with planes audible but generally "not obnoxiously loud."

The campground provides "full hookup sites," a highly sought-after amenity for RV campers, making it convenient for those rolling out their fifth wheel or other recreational vehicles. Finding such sites, especially with "less than a week advance notice" over a holiday break in California, is described as "nearly unheard of," underscoring the campground's excellent availability even during peak times. The facilities are universally praised: "Everything is new, well maintained, and in excellent condition." Specifically, "The bathrooms are clean" and "spotless," a critical factor for camper satisfaction. Additional amenities include "laundry facilities," providing a practical convenience for longer stays, and "firewood available" for purchase, ensuring campers can enjoy traditional campfire experiences. The staff are noted as "very friendly and helpful," contributing to a welcoming and supportive environment. A specific rule, "you can't drive into the park past 10 PM," is in place, but ride-sharing services and walking are permitted, indicating a balance between security and accessibility.
